SUMMARY A method, utilizing freeze substitution, is described for the preparation of plant tissue for analytical electron microscopy. The fine structure of the cytoplasm was adequately preserved after freezing leaf tissue in 2‐methylbutane at −170°C. Furthermore, following substitution in ether, losses of sodium and potassium from the tissue were less than 4% of the original ion content and the loss of chloride was less than 1%. The merits of the procedure as a means of tissue preparation for ion localization studies are discussed.
